摘要
The main purpose of this paper is to establish the existence and multiplicity of nontrivial solutions for a quasilinear Neumann problem with critical exponent. It is shown, by the methods of the Lions concentration-compactness principle and the mountain pass lemma, that under certain conditions, the existence of nontrivial solutions are obtained.
